Build:
  1. 0
2026-06-24 19:17.26: New job: build mirage-dns.3.1.3 (59f962a49cac)
2026-06-24 19:17.26: Waiting for resource in pool day11-builds
2026-06-24 19:29.35: Got resource from pool day11-builds
2026-06-24 19:29.35: [profile full] build mirage-dns.3.1.3
2026-06-24 19:29.35: build mirage-dns.3.1.3 (59f962a49cac)
=== DEPENDENCIES (57 transitive) ===
  angstrom.0.16.1                                    49f06d53b59a
  base.v0.15.2                                       ea95604dcd06
  base-bytes.base                                    b739da2a1ca5
  base-threads.base                                  c9e7bdbf5823
  base-unix.base                                     7d1428be9ddb
  base64.3.5.2                                       fc1f66ad4153
  bigarray-compat.1.1.0                              56aac2f329b1
  bigstringaf.0.10.0                                 dc648b47a3c3
  cppo.1.8.0                                         2e6d5a70492d
  csexp.1.5.2                                        cbff46c78e23
  cstruct.5.2.0                                      b475fb30accb
  dns.1.1.3                                          2ce01b13f954
  dns-lwt.1.1.3                                      3bc8484315ed
  domain-name.0.5.0                                  f9f77271314e
  dune.3.23.1                                        ec34fe9ebf2c
  dune-configurator.3.22.2                           f3081e3d47cb
  duration.0.3.1                                     cff6a69a04a0
  fmt.0.11.0                                         310eac9631dd
  hashcons.1.4.0                                     6d9f6ec775bc
  ipaddr.5.6.2                                       bfde257a8fff
  lwt.5.10.0                                         53ae1d1ba510
  macaddr.5.6.2                                      f5b7b23ec99f
  mirage-device.1.2.0                                da7543bdbe34
  mirage-flow.1.6.0                                  2804628657ef
  mirage-kv.2.0.0                                    57371bf0d464
  mirage-kv-lwt.2.0.0                                03112087f877
  mirage-net.2.0.0                                   267eb40fac14
  mirage-profile.0.9.1                               51329e543cb9
  mirage-protocols.3.1.0                             4096dd179538
  mirage-stack.1.4.0                                 30c2ad571bff
  mirage-stack-lwt.1.4.0                             4b36bbb79dc6
  mirage-time.1.3.0                                  d94791238be4
  mirage-time-lwt.1.3.0                              b900928ad3af
  num.1.6                                            0d0867ee79d1
  ocaml.4.12.1                                       dee35ad2ab01
  ocaml-base-compiler.4.12.1                         16a69ab1424d
  ocaml-config.2                                     e77f021f2144
  ocaml-migrate-parsetree.1.8.0                      73b42abd5080
  ocaml-secondary-compiler.4.14.2                    fb63d435ed9e
  ocaml-syntax-shims.1.0.0                           0bbcec0141dc
  ocamlbuild.0.16.1                                  2ce5a99932fe
  ocamlfind.1.9.6                                    8d8d9a490c0f
  ocamlfind-secondary.1.9.6                          e7e9f5a4b1a5
  ocplib-endian.1.2                                  5c1573509b5d
  parsexp.v0.15.0                                    a573a606868d
  ppx_cstruct.5.2.0                                  501ba1bb7513
  ppx_derivers.1.2.1                                 e2df7d6ecda0
  ppx_tools_versioned.5.4.0                          92222031b774
  re.1.12.0                                          60dc06e091f9
  result.1.5                                         b2f02c331fa8
  seq.base                                           67d9aec3c6ca
  sexplib.v0.15.1                                    848b1fc6b213
  sexplib0.v0.15.1                                   52604d5b3c08
  stdlib-shims.0.3.0                                 1590dd69ad83
  stringext.1.6.0                                    5f9404a111cf
  topkg.1.1.1                                        2f204787554a
  uri.4.4.0                                          02df15d565c6
=== STDOUT ===
Processing: [default: loading data]
[mirage-dns.3.1.3: extract]
-> retrieved mirage-dns.3.1.3  (cached)
[mirage-dns: dune build]
+ /home/opam/.opam/default/bin/dune "build" "-p" "mirage-dns" "-j" "39" (CWD=/home/opam/.opam/default/.opam-switch/build/mirage-dns.3.1.3)
- (cd _build/default && /home/opam/.opam/default/bin/ocamlc.opt -w -40 -g -bin-annot -I mirage/.mirage_dns.objs/byte -I /home/opam/.opam/default/lib/angstrom -I /home/opam/.opam/default/lib/base64 -I /home/opam/.opam/default/lib/bigarray-compat -I /home/opam/.opam/default/lib/bigstringaf -I /home/opam/.opam/default/lib/bytes -I /home/opam/.opam/default/lib/cstruct -I /home/opam/.opam/default/lib/dns -I /home/opam/.opam/default/lib/dns-lwt -I /home/opam/.opam/default/lib/domain-name -I /home/opam/.opam/default/lib/duration -I /home/opam/.opam/default/lib/fmt -I /home/opam/.opam/default/lib/hashcons -I /home/opam/.opam/default/lib/ipaddr -I /home/opam/.opam/default/lib/lwt -I /home/opam/.opam/default/lib/macaddr -I /home/opam/.opam/default/lib/mirage-device -I /home/opam/.opam/default/lib/mirage-flow -I /home/opam/.opam/default/lib/mirage-kv -I /home/opam/.opam/default/lib/mirage-kv-lwt -I /home/opam/.opam/default/lib/mirage-net -I /home/opam/.opam/default/lib/mirage-profile -I /home/opam/.opam/default/lib/mirage-protocols -I /home/opam/.opam/default/lib/mirage-stack -I /home/opam/.opam/default/lib/mirage-stack-lwt -I /home/opam/.opam/default/lib/mirage-time -I /home/opam/.opam/default/lib/mirage-time-lwt -I /home/opam/.opam/default/lib/ocplib-endian -I /home/opam/.opam/default/lib/ocplib-endian/bigstring -I /home/opam/.opam/default/lib/re -I /home/opam/.opam/default/lib/re/str -I /home/opam/.opam/default/lib/result -I /home/opam/.opam/default/lib/seq -I /home/opam/.opam/default/lib/stdlib-shims -I /home/opam/.opam/default/lib/stringext -I /home/opam/.opam/default/lib/uri -I /home/opam/.opam/default/lib/uri/services -intf-suffix .ml -no-alias-deps -o mirage/.mirage_dns.objs/byte/dns_server_mirage.cmo -c -impl mirage/dns_server_mirage.ml)
- File "mirage/dns_server_mirage.ml", line 44, characters 22-31:
- 44 |   let fail_load fmt = Fmt.kstrf failwith ("Dns_server_mirage: " ^^ fmt)
-                            ^^^^^^^^^
- Alert deprecated: Fmt.kstrf
- use Fmt.kstr instead.
- (cd _build/default && /home/opam/.opam/default/bin/ocamlopt.opt -w -40 -g -I mirage/.mirage_dns.objs/byte -I mirage/.mirage_dns.objs/native -I /home/opam/.opam/default/lib/angstrom -I /home/opam/.opam/default/lib/base64 -I /home/opam/.opam/default/lib/bigarray-compat -I /home/opam/.opam/default/lib/bigstringaf -I /home/opam/.opam/default/lib/bytes -I /home/opam/.opam/default/lib/cstruct -I /home/opam/.opam/default/lib/dns -I /home/opam/.opam/default/lib/dns-lwt -I /home/opam/.opam/default/lib/domain-name -I /home/opam/.opam/default/lib/duration -I /home/opam/.opam/default/lib/fmt -I /home/opam/.opam/default/lib/hashcons -I /home/opam/.opam/default/lib/ipaddr -I /home/opam/.opam/default/lib/lwt -I /home/opam/.opam/default/lib/macaddr -I /home/opam/.opam/default/lib/mirage-device -I /home/opam/.opam/default/lib/mirage-flow -I /home/opam/.opam/default/lib/mirage-kv -I /home/opam/.opam/default/lib/mirage-kv-lwt -I /home/opam/.opam/default/lib/mirage-net -I /home/opam/.opam/default/lib/mirage-profile -I /home/opam/.opam/default/lib/mirage-protocols -I /home/opam/.opam/default/lib/mirage-stack -I /home/opam/.opam/default/lib/mirage-stack-lwt -I /home/opam/.opam/default/lib/mirage-time -I /home/opam/.opam/default/lib/mirage-time-lwt -I /home/opam/.opam/default/lib/ocplib-endian -I /home/opam/.opam/default/lib/ocplib-endian/bigstring -I /home/opam/.opam/default/lib/re -I /home/opam/.opam/default/lib/re/str -I /home/opam/.opam/default/lib/result -I /home/opam/.opam/default/lib/seq -I /home/opam/.opam/default/lib/stdlib-shims -I /home/opam/.opam/default/lib/stringext -I /home/opam/.opam/default/lib/uri -I /home/opam/.opam/default/lib/uri/services -intf-suffix .ml -no-alias-deps -o mirage/.mirage_dns.objs/native/dns_server_mirage.cmx -c -impl mirage/dns_server_mirage.ml)
- File "mirage/dns_server_mirage.ml", line 44, characters 22-31:
- 44 |   let fail_load fmt = Fmt.kstrf failwith ("Dns_server_mirage: " ^^ fmt)
-                            ^^^^^^^^^
- Alert deprecated: Fmt.kstrf
- use Fmt.kstr instead.
- (cd _build/default && /home/opam/.opam/default/bin/ocamlc.opt -w -40 -g -bin-annot -I mirage/.mirage_dns.objs/byte -I /home/opam/.opam/default/lib/angstrom -I /home/opam/.opam/default/lib/base64 -I /home/opam/.opam/default/lib/bigarray-compat -I /home/opam/.opam/default/lib/bigstringaf -I /home/opam/.opam/default/lib/bytes -I /home/opam/.opam/default/lib/cstruct -I /home/opam/.opam/default/lib/dns -I /home/opam/.opam/default/lib/dns-lwt -I /home/opam/.opam/default/lib/domain-name -I /home/opam/.opam/default/lib/duration -I /home/opam/.opam/default/lib/fmt -I /home/opam/.opam/default/lib/hashcons -I /home/opam/.opam/default/lib/ipaddr -I /home/opam/.opam/default/lib/lwt -I /home/opam/.opam/default/lib/macaddr -I /home/opam/.opam/default/lib/mirage-device -I /home/opam/.opam/default/lib/mirage-flow -I /home/opam/.opam/default/lib/mirage-kv -I /home/opam/.opam/default/lib/mirage-kv-lwt -I /home/opam/.opam/default/lib/mirage-net -I /home/opam/.opam/default/lib/mirage-profile -I /home/opam/.opam/default/lib/mirage-protocols -I /home/opam/.opam/default/lib/mirage-stack -I /home/opam/.opam/default/lib/mirage-stack-lwt -I /home/opam/.opam/default/lib/mirage-time -I /home/opam/.opam/default/lib/mirage-time-lwt -I /home/opam/.opam/default/lib/ocplib-endian -I /home/opam/.opam/default/lib/ocplib-endian/bigstring -I /home/opam/.opam/default/lib/re -I /home/opam/.opam/default/lib/re/str -I /home/opam/.opam/default/lib/result -I /home/opam/.opam/default/lib/seq -I /home/opam/.opam/default/lib/stdlib-shims -I /home/opam/.opam/default/lib/stringext -I /home/opam/.opam/default/lib/uri -I /home/opam/.opam/default/lib/uri/services -intf-suffix .ml -no-alias-deps -o mirage/.mirage_dns.objs/byte/dns_resolver_mirage.cmo -c -impl mirage/dns_resolver_mirage.ml)
- File "mirage/dns_resolver_mirage.ml", line 113, characters 10-19:
- 113 |           Fmt.kstrf fail_with
-                 ^^^^^^^^^
- Alert deprecated: Fmt.kstrf
- use Fmt.kstr instead.
- (cd _build/default && /home/opam/.opam/default/bin/ocamlopt.opt -w -40 -g -I mirage/.mirage_dns.objs/byte -I mirage/.mirage_dns.objs/native -I /home/opam/.opam/default/lib/angstrom -I /home/opam/.opam/default/lib/base64 -I /home/opam/.opam/default/lib/bigarray-compat -I /home/opam/.opam/default/lib/bigstringaf -I /home/opam/.opam/default/lib/bytes -I /home/opam/.opam/default/lib/cstruct -I /home/opam/.opam/default/lib/dns -I /home/opam/.opam/default/lib/dns-lwt -I /home/opam/.opam/default/lib/domain-name -I /home/opam/.opam/default/lib/duration -I /home/opam/.opam/default/lib/fmt -I /home/opam/.opam/default/lib/hashcons -I /home/opam/.opam/default/lib/ipaddr -I /home/opam/.opam/default/lib/lwt -I /home/opam/.opam/default/lib/macaddr -I /home/opam/.opam/default/lib/mirage-device -I /home/opam/.opam/default/lib/mirage-flow -I /home/opam/.opam/default/lib/mirage-kv -I /home/opam/.opam/default/lib/mirage-kv-lwt -I /home/opam/.opam/default/lib/mirage-net -I /home/opam/.opam/default/lib/mirage-profile -I /home/opam/.opam/default/lib/mirage-protocols -I /home/opam/.opam/default/lib/mirage-stack -I /home/opam/.opam/default/lib/mirage-stack-lwt -I /home/opam/.opam/default/lib/mirage-time -I /home/opam/.opam/default/lib/mirage-time-lwt -I /home/opam/.opam/default/lib/ocplib-endian -I /home/opam/.opam/default/lib/ocplib-endian/bigstring -I /home/opam/.opam/default/lib/re -I /home/opam/.opam/default/lib/re/str -I /home/opam/.opam/default/lib/result -I /home/opam/.opam/default/lib/seq -I /home/opam/.opam/default/lib/stdlib-shims -I /home/opam/.opam/default/lib/stringext -I /home/opam/.opam/default/lib/uri -I /home/opam/.opam/default/lib/uri/services -intf-suffix .ml -no-alias-deps -o mirage/.mirage_dns.objs/native/dns_resolver_mirage.cmx -c -impl mirage/dns_resolver_mirage.ml)
- File "mirage/dns_resolver_mirage.ml", line 113, characters 10-19:
- 113 |           Fmt.kstrf fail_with
-                 ^^^^^^^^^
- Alert deprecated: Fmt.kstrf
- use Fmt.kstr instead.
- (cd _build/default && /home/opam/.opam/default/bin/ocamlc.opt -w -40 -g -bin-annot -I mirage/.mirage_dns.objs/byte -I /home/opam/.opam/default/lib/angstrom -I /home/opam/.opam/default/lib/base64 -I /home/opam/.opam/default/lib/bigarray-compat -I /home/opam/.opam/default/lib/bigstringaf -I /home/opam/.opam/default/lib/bytes -I /home/opam/.opam/default/lib/cstruct -I /home/opam/.opam/default/lib/dns -I /home/opam/.opam/default/lib/dns-lwt -I /home/opam/.opam/default/lib/domain-name -I /home/opam/.opam/default/lib/duration -I /home/opam/.opam/default/lib/fmt -I /home/opam/.opam/default/lib/hashcons -I /home/opam/.opam/default/lib/ipaddr -I /home/opam/.opam/default/lib/lwt -I /home/opam/.opam/default/lib/macaddr -I /home/opam/.opam/default/lib/mirage-device -I /home/opam/.opam/default/lib/mirage-flow -I /home/opam/.opam/default/lib/mirage-kv -I /home/opam/.opam/default/lib/mirage-kv-lwt -I /home/opam/.opam/default/lib/mirage-net -I /home/opam/.opam/default/lib/mirage-profile -I /home/opam/.opam/default/lib/mirage-protocols -I /home/opam/.opam/default/lib/mirage-stack -I /home/opam/.opam/default/lib/mirage-stack-lwt -I /home/opam/.opam/default/lib/mirage-time -I /home/opam/.opam/default/lib/mirage-time-lwt -I /home/opam/.opam/default/lib/ocplib-endian -I /home/opam/.opam/default/lib/ocplib-endian/bigstring -I /home/opam/.opam/default/lib/re -I /home/opam/.opam/default/lib/re/str -I /home/opam/.opam/default/lib/result -I /home/opam/.opam/default/lib/seq -I /home/opam/.opam/default/lib/stdlib-shims -I /home/opam/.opam/default/lib/stringext -I /home/opam/.opam/default/lib/uri -I /home/opam/.opam/default/lib/uri/services -intf-suffix .ml -no-alias-deps -o mirage/.mirage_dns.objs/byte/mdns_resolver_mirage.cmo -c -impl mirage/mdns_resolver_mirage.ml)
- File "mirage/mdns_resolver_mirage.ml", line 102, characters 10-19:
- 102 |           Fmt.kstrf fail_with
-                 ^^^^^^^^^
- Alert deprecated: Fmt.kstrf
- use Fmt.kstr instead.
- (cd _build/default && /home/opam/.opam/default/bin/ocamlopt.opt -w -40 -g -I mirage/.mirage_dns.objs/byte -I mirage/.mirage_dns.objs/native -I /home/opam/.opam/default/lib/angstrom -I /home/opam/.opam/default/lib/base64 -I /home/opam/.opam/default/lib/bigarray-compat -I /home/opam/.opam/default/lib/bigstringaf -I /home/opam/.opam/default/lib/bytes -I /home/opam/.opam/default/lib/cstruct -I /home/opam/.opam/default/lib/dns -I /home/opam/.opam/default/lib/dns-lwt -I /home/opam/.opam/default/lib/domain-name -I /home/opam/.opam/default/lib/duration -I /home/opam/.opam/default/lib/fmt -I /home/opam/.opam/default/lib/hashcons -I /home/opam/.opam/default/lib/ipaddr -I /home/opam/.opam/default/lib/lwt -I /home/opam/.opam/default/lib/macaddr -I /home/opam/.opam/default/lib/mirage-device -I /home/opam/.opam/default/lib/mirage-flow -I /home/opam/.opam/default/lib/mirage-kv -I /home/opam/.opam/default/lib/mirage-kv-lwt -I /home/opam/.opam/default/lib/mirage-net -I /home/opam/.opam/default/lib/mirage-profile -I /home/opam/.opam/default/lib/mirage-protocols -I /home/opam/.opam/default/lib/mirage-stack -I /home/opam/.opam/default/lib/mirage-stack-lwt -I /home/opam/.opam/default/lib/mirage-time -I /home/opam/.opam/default/lib/mirage-time-lwt -I /home/opam/.opam/default/lib/ocplib-endian -I /home/opam/.opam/default/lib/ocplib-endian/bigstring -I /home/opam/.opam/default/lib/re -I /home/opam/.opam/default/lib/re/str -I /home/opam/.opam/default/lib/result -I /home/opam/.opam/default/lib/seq -I /home/opam/.opam/default/lib/stdlib-shims -I /home/opam/.opam/default/lib/stringext -I /home/opam/.opam/default/lib/uri -I /home/opam/.opam/default/lib/uri/services -intf-suffix .ml -no-alias-deps -o mirage/.mirage_dns.objs/native/mdns_resolver_mirage.cmx -c -impl mirage/mdns_resolver_mirage.ml)
- File "mirage/mdns_resolver_mirage.ml", line 102, characters 10-19:
- 102 |           Fmt.kstrf fail_with
-                 ^^^^^^^^^
- Alert deprecated: Fmt.kstrf
- use Fmt.kstr instead.
-> compiled  mirage-dns.3.1.3
-> installed mirage-dns.3.1.3

=== STDERR ===

2026-06-24 19:29.53: OK: build mirage-dns.3.1.3 (runc: 1.6s, disk: 23KB)
2026-06-24 19:29.53: Job succeeded